Daryl Murphy Celtic newsShould Neil Lennon start with Daryl Murphy for Wednesday’s match with Hearts at Tynecastle?

The former Sunderland man put in an impressive performance in the 2-0 win over Kilmarnock complete with his Rab C Nesbitt bandage which could well be available from the Celtic Megastore before the season ends.

Murphy had a hand in both goals today and was certainly a handful for the Kilmarnock defence.

After spending most of the season watching Gary Hooper and Anthony Stokes from the stand or subs bench Murphy is the freshest forward at the club.

Hooper and Stokes have been showing signs of wear and tear recently with the former Scunthorpe striker failing to recapture his form since Madjid Bougherra raked his studs down his calf during Celtic’s 1-0 Scottish Cup replay win over Rangers at the start of March.

Tynecastle on Wednesday night is going to be an evening of blood and snotters as Tommy Burns once memorably gave an alternative description to a ‘good old fashined cup-tie’.

The pressures and tensions normally present when Celtic visit Gorgie will be notched up a level or three with the locals desperate to bury Neil Lennon’s title challenge regardless of how Tuesday’s Dundee United-Rangers match goes.

While not sacrificing the style of play that has become Celtic’s hallmark this season a more direct approach will be called for on Wednesday.

[poll id=”45″]

Stokes and Georgios Samaras will be available again after suspension but after the relative success of Murphy and Hooper today I think Lennon will opt for the same combination to start against Hearts.

Murphy won a lot of headers that provided the ball to Hooper and Kris Commons who combined well together and threatened the Killie defence.

Midfield will be the main battleground with Ian Black bound to be heavily involved- he usually is.

In his last three team selections Lennon has gone with two central midfielders flanked by wide men such as Jamie Forrest, Kris Commons or Shaun Maloney

Against Hearts a more solid midfield will be required selecting just one wide player. Drafting in Efrain Juarez or Charlie Mulgrew must be tempting for Lennon with Tynecastle not reknowned for providing the space for players like Maloney or Forrest.

With the back four almost picking itself I’d like to suggest this team to get the points at Tynecastle to take the title race to the final day is

Forster; Wilson, Majstorovic, Rogne, Izaguirre; Mulgrew, Commons, Ki, Brown; Murphy, Hooper
